Building on the success of their womenswear partnership, ASOS and adidas Originals launch their first-ever menswear collection. Available exclusively on ASOS from 29 July 2026 for ASOS.WORLD loyalty customers, and from 30 July to all customers globally, the debut collection marks the first expansion of the partnership beyond womenswear.Created for a customer whose style is increasingly shaped by the crossover between sport, fashion and culture. Rooted in adidas Originals’ sporting heritage and reimagined through ASOS’ British fashion lens, it combines tailored influences, elevated fabrication and iconic sportswear silhouettes to create a wardrobe designed to move seamlessly between different moments of everyday life.

Fronting the campaign is league-winning Arsenal FC and England footballer Noni Madueke, whose international influence on and off the pitch reflects the growing connection between sport, personal style and culture. Known for his distinctive personal style, Madueke brings an authenticity that reflects the spirit of the collection.

Signature adidas Originals pieces are reimagined with a tailored edge. The Firebird tracksuit appears in a soft brown check, while classic track pants are crafted in suiting-inspired fabrications that reflect the continued influence of tailoring within contemporary menswear. Overshirts and knitwear featuring the iconic 3-Stripes sit alongside more refined silhouettes, creating styling opportunities that move effortlessly between casual and more elevated looks.

Preppy influences including rugby shirts and knitted vests further reinforce the crossover between sport and style, creating a curated wardrobe built around versatility. Sharpe proportions, premium suede and heritage-inspired prints add depth throughout the collection, while heavyweight knitwear and elevated fabrication ensure each piece feels considered and fashion-led.

A tonal palette of brown, tan and neutrals is punctuated by pastel blue and green accents, creating a collection designed to slot naturally into existing wardrobes while maintaining a confident point of view.

Following the huge success of three standout womenswear collections, expanding our partnership with ASOS into menswear was a natural next step, opening up an exciting opportunity to bring adidas Originals to an even broader audience. Marking this new chapter alongside adidas athlete Noni Madueke helps further connect our sporting heritage with today’s fashion landscape, Steve Marks, VP Brand, adidas North Europe.

The success of our womenswear partnership gave us the confidence to take the collaboration into menswear for the first time.

At a moment when sport is shaping culture and personal style in ways that feel impossible to ignore, we wanted to create product that reflected how our customers want to dress today. By reinterpreting iconic adidas Originals silhouettes through our British fashion lens, we’ve created a collection that brings together sport, fashion and self-expression in a way that feels relevant to modern menswear. Vanessa Spence, Executive Vice President, Brand and Creative at ASOS.

Customers can access the collection exclusively on ASOS and virtually try on select styled looks to see themselves (or a virtual model of their choice) in the outfits and share them with friends. The virtual try-on capability, powered by AI fashion plat form AIUTA, is available globally on the iOS app.
